The Tinée is a river in France, which runs in the Provence- Alpes -Cote d' Azur in the Alpes - Maritimes. It rises near the Col de la Bonette in the Mercantour National Park, in the municipality of Saint- Dalmas- le -Selvage, drained generally southeast through the area of the Maritime Alps and flows after 70 kilometers of the municipal boundary of Utelle and Tournefort as a left tributary of the Var.

Energy

The river is dammed at several points for energy. The water is derived by pressure tunnel.
